AMD spec promises better software parallelism

Speed up your apps, p'rapps
Tue Aug 14 2007, 10:51
CHIP FIRM AMD said it has released a spec which will improve software app performance.

The spec, which the marchitecture boys call "Light Weight Profiling", takes advantage of hardware extensions in multiple core processors, said AMD.

The specification is available in PDF form, here.

If you want light reading on your summer holiday on the beaches of Europe, this stuff probably won't fit the bill. But if you're a software developer and parallelism makes your pulse beat faster and puts roses in your cheeks, AMD wants to hear from you. µ
